Brake parts should be easy to find on Rockauto.com or from most major internet parts houses.
Adapting seats from another vehicle isn’t uncommon if you are having trouble finding an original one. You’re kinda stuck because shipping one from out of state is costly. You can post a ‘parts wanted’ ad in the appropriate classified forum and likely find a radio. Just because you haven’t seen one posted for sale doesn’t mean they’re not out there. Front fender patch panels can be fabricated locally by a decent body guy, most the ones available don’t usually fit well and need a lot of reworking anyway.
